  10. AM I READY TO BUY? Do you have… • A monthly budget or spending plan? • Steady income and employment history? • A manageable level of current debt? • A record of paying your bills on time? • Some money for down payment? Not there yet? We’re here to help!

MORTGAGE ASSISTANCE PROGRAM • 2nd Mortgage up to $50k • Low down payment ($500), lowers monthly payments through eliminating mortgage insurance • Income eligibility: 100% Median Family Income or under • Low interest rates, fixed terms • Available in Multnomah and Washington Counties ML - 4654

  19. MAP COMPARISON FHA Insured Loan:Conv. Loan w/MAP 2nd: Purchase Price: $200,000 Purchase Price: $200,000 Monthly Payment: $1,362 Monthly Payment: $1,388 Mortgage Insurance: $88.46 Mortgage Insurance: None Cash to Close: $8,760 Cash to Close: $534 *Both examples factor in $6,000 in seller paid closing costs. If this is not possible, the additional costs can be rolled into the MAP loan. ML - 4654

  20. PHC IDA PROGRAM • Matched savings program – for each $1 you save, we match $3 • Can help you gain up to $9,000 for home purchase • 80% of median family income to qualify How to get started… • Complete IDA Application • Complete Financial Fitness • Meet with a HomeBuying Specialist

  21. OREGON BOND LOAN(CURRENTLY SUSPENDED) • Lower than market 30 year fixed interest rate (this lowers your monthly payments or increases your purchasing power!) • Income cap: 1-2 person household $79,190 3 or more person household $91,068 • 9 year recapture period www.oregonbond.us
